Significance
Phenomenal growth of construction industry that depends upon depletable resources.
• Huge quantities of waste and byproducts generated every year.
• E.G. Fly ash –70-75 million tons/yr,
Blast furnace slag – 10 million tons/yr
• Perennial pressures on land and environment.
• Degree of environmental impact

Low environmental impact materials
Environmental impact
1. Utilizing almost zero energy industrial waste to replace energy intensive material.
2. Reduction in the use of high-energy materials such as cement, concrete, steel etc by absolute volume when compared with equivalent products for the same application.
3. Effective savings in the primary grade raw materials, cumulative embodied energy, labour and capital investments.
Low VOC finishes
•Zero/low voc paints
•Use only low VOC paints,100% of all paints used in the interior of the building must be certified as containing zero or less than 150 gms/ltr ofVOCs per gallon.
• Environmental impact –
• Wide varieties of volatiles are released through oxidation by both solvent- based and water-based paints which
can be injurious to lung health and can be odorous.
